Zubair lauded consensus of all political parties on CPEC

byCT Report
30/05/2015
in Business
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

ISLAMABAD: State Minister for Privatization Muhammad Zubair on Friday said that consensus of all political parties on China-Pakistan Economic Corridor was pleasant.

CPEC project would prove as a game changer in the whole region, he added.

He said that it was a wrong perception that this project would be beneficial for one province but it would open new ways of development for whole region.

Replying to a question, he said Gwadar is the central point of CPEC project and do not make it controversial.

The minister lauded the previous government which had passed the NFC award through consensus and all provinces were taking benefit through it.

He said that PML-N leadership wanted to see Pakistan as an economic power and make the country as an Asian tiger.

He said that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if always gave priority to national interest, adding that direct investment of China was great achievement of Pakistan Muslim League Nawaz (PML-N) and its leadership.
